Carlton Colville
Poplar Road sits within a calm, well‑established residential pocket of Carlton Colville. It’s tucked just off The Street, so you get a quieter setting while still being close to everyday amenities and straightforward routes around town. Shops are easy to reach: Carlton Colville Service Station is the nearest stop for quick essentials, and a short drive north brings you to Pakefield Retail Park, which includes larger stores such as Aldi, B&M and Home Bargains. Lowestoft Road and Pakefield add more choice with small independents, cafés and takeaways, giving residents a mix of practical convenience and local character.
Schools are close and varied. Carlton Colville Primary School sits within walking distance, and Grove Primary School is also nearby. Pakefield expands the options with Pakefield Primary School and Pakefield High School, making the area straightforward for families who want short, simple school runs.
Transport links are practical: regular bus services run along Poplar Road and Lowestoft Road, connecting directly into Lowestoft, Kessingland and Pakefield. Road access is simple too, with quick routes toward the A12 for commuting or weekend trips.
